NFL Wild Card: New Orleans Saints double-digit home favorites vs. Chicago Bears

During NFL Wild Card Weekend, the Chicago Bears (8-8) visit the New Orleans Saints (12-4) Sunday in an NFC Wild Card tilt at 4:40 p.m. ET. Below, we take a look at the early Bears-Saints betting odds and lines at BetMGM Sportsbook.

The Bears backdoored their way into the postseason. Despite losing at home to the Green Bay Packers 35-16 in Week 17, Chicago claimed the NFC's No. 7 and final seed when the Arizona Cardinals (8-8) lost at the Los Angeles Rams. The Bears were 5-1 after Week 6 but lost each of their next six games. A three-game win streak against a trio of struggling teams - the Houston Texans, Minnesota Vikings and Jacksonville Jaguars - found the Bears back in contention heading into the regular-season finale. Midseason offensive line changes resulted in giving QB Mitchell Trubisky (2,055 passing yards, 16 touchdowns, 8 interceptions) enough protection, and it opened holes for the running game, which has produced six consecutive 100-yard games after failing to reach the century mark in the previous seven. RB David Montgomery ran for 598 of his 1,070 regular-season rushing yards in those six games, averaging 5.16 yards per carry.

Despite missing several key players, the Saints closed the regular season with a 33-7 rout at the Carolina Panthers as 6-point favorites. QB Drew Brees threw for 201 yards with 3 touchdowns and no interceptions, while the defense finished with 5 picks. RB Alvin Kamara, RB Latavius Murray, S C.J. Gardner-Johnson and S Marcus Williams didn't play due to COVID-19 protocols, and WR Michael Thomas is on the Reserve/Injured list due to an ankle injury. The good news is they could all be back for Sunday's playoff game vs. the Bears. New Orleans won 26-23 at Chicago in Week 8, but needed overtime. Brees threw for 280 yards and 2 TDs in the victory, while QB Nick Foles (272 passing yards, 2 TDs, 1 INT) started for the Bears.

Bears at Saints: Betting odds, spread and line

Odds via BetMGM; last updated Tuesday at 6:30 a.m. ET.

  • Money line: Bears +375 (bet $100 to win $375) | Saints -500 (bet $500 to win $100) | Bet now
  • Against the spread/ATS: Bears +10, -115 (bet $115 to win $100) | Saints -10, -105 (bet $105 to win $100) | Bet now
  • Total: 47.5, Over -110 (bet $110 to win $100) | Under -110 (bet $110 to win $100) | Bet now

At +375 odds, the Bears have an implied 21.05% chance of winning or 15/4 fractional odds. Chicago needs to win outright, or lose by fewer than 10 points for a Bears +10 (-115) ATS ticket to cash. A 10-point loss is a push and you get your money back.

At -500 odds, the Saints have an implied 83.33% chance of winning, or 1/5 fractional odds. New Orleans needs to win by at least 11 points for a Saints -10 (-105) ticket to cash.
